Handover — consent banner rollout (project Lanternfold). Staged rollout at 40%, region-gated. Variant B live in Ostenbrook market only. Known issue: banner re-fires after locale switch; fix queued. Do not bump rollout percentage without legal checklist signed. Dashboards under "lanternfold-consent." Config flags documented in the runbook. Escalations and all rollout-percentage changes go through the rollout owner named below.

named custodian: Brivan Eliath Quenox Frador

Subject: DR drill next week — slim images edition

Hi plugin folks,

Heads-up from the Ostermark platform team: next Wednesday's disaster-recovery drill will rebuild the whole registry from our new slimmed base images. If your plugin still depends on the fat runtime image, it may fail to start on the standby cluster — please test against `slim-base` before then. During the drill, the registry vault gets re-sealed, and you'll unlock it with the passphrase below.

vault phrase of bagaf-kajeg = jorath-feniel-briir-siliel-ralix

Subject: Key rotation for Larkspur SFTP drop

Team,

Heads up for the weekly sync: the partner SFTP drop for Larkspur Logistics rotates this Thursday. Uploads will pause for roughly ten minutes at 09:00. The ingest worker picks up the new credential automatically; only the manifest poller needs a manual update. Flag any stuck transfers to Priya. The new key for the poller is below.

API key for fadup-tadug: vxb23-eAKAplAIXbksJHWEnzMeawU

Hey, flagging this for security review. Since last night's deploy, the Mapletile tile-rendering cache layer rejects every warm-cache artifact with "signature mismatch." Looks like the build box in the Orvane region is still signing with the pre-rotation key, so verification on the edge nodes fails. Nothing malicious as far as I can tell — just a rotation that half-landed. Re-signed one artifact manually and it verified fine. For reference, the key the edge nodes currently trust is the following.

deploy key for kajof-fajop: bky6_gDHw9Q